Lock it down before break! NO BROKERAGE FEE OR SECURITY DEPOSIT DUE!
74 Egmont Street, Brookline, MA 02446
4 Beds12 Month Lease
34 Rentals Available

74 Egmont Street, Brookline, MA 02446
4 Beds12 Month Lease

76 Egmont Street 5, Brookline, MA 02446
4 Beds12 Month Lease


73 Thatcher Street, Brookline, MA 02446
4 Beds12 Month Lease

76 Egmont Street 5, Brookline, MA 02446
4 Beds12 Month Lease

60 Egmont Street, Brookline, MA 02446
3 Beds12 Month Lease

1223 Beacon St, Brookline, MA 02446
Studio - 3 Beds12 Month Lease

330 Saint Paul Street, Brookline, MA 02446
2 Beds12 Month Lease







